After years of Cat Spring calls, these sources come up again and again.
Worn supply lines behind appliances fail gradually, and water can spread through a Cat Spring property for hours before anyone catches it, soaking into flooring and cabinetry along the way.
Heavy storms and aging roofing materials contribute to water intrusion in Cat Spring properties, especially in older roof systems nearing the end of their lifespan and due for replacement.
A failed sump pump is one of the fastest ways a Cat Spring basement floods — often within a single storm, with little warning beforehand.
A failing water heater can leak for weeks, often causing more structural damage than a sudden burst would have caused.
Improper grading around a Cat Spring property's foundation directs rainwater toward the structure instead of away, causing chronic basement moisture over time.
HVAC condensation lines and mechanical equipment can leak slowly for weeks in Cat Spring properties, often going unnoticed until a ceiling stain or musty smell appears.

Here's what actually drives the cost of a Burst Pipe Cleanup job in Cat Spring, explained plainly before you ever get a bill.
The biggest factor is usually the source and category of water involved. Clean water from a supply line costs less to remediate than contaminated water from a sewage backup, which requires additional sanitizing and, in some cases, disposal of porous materials that can't be safely dried. The size of the affected area and how long the water sat before extraction also play a major role.
The type of materials affected changes the number significantly. We assess your specific Cat Spring property on-site and give you a number based on what's actually there, not a rough guess over the phone.
Understanding how Cat Spring's seasons affect water risk can help property owners know what to watch for.
Cold snaps bring the risk of frozen and burst pipes, especially in older Cat Spring homes with pipes running through unheated attics, crawlspaces, and exterior walls. Warmer months bring heavy rain and storm systems capable of overwhelming drainage and roofing that's been slowly deteriorating all year.

Here's what our dispatchers typically walk Cat Spring callers through while a technician is en route.
If the water is coming from a pipe or appliance you can safely reach, shut off the supply valve or main line.
Never touch switches, outlets, or appliances near standing water — the shock risk is real.
Relocating valuables and lifting rugs can reduce secondary damage while you wait.
A quick photo record of standing water and affected belongings smooths out the claims process.
If weather allows, opening windows can help slow humidity buildup until our Cat Spring team arrives with drying equipment.

Plenty of Cat Spring property owners try handling a small water event themselves before calling us. Here's what usually gets missed.
What makes DIY cleanup risky isn't the initial mop-up — it's everything you can't see afterward. Household fans move air across a surface, but they don't pull moisture out of building materials the way commercial dehumidifiers do, and that gap is where Cat Spring homeowners end up with mold problems months later.
There's also the insurance side. Without professional documentation — moisture readings, photos, a written scope — it's harder to support a claim if secondary damage shows up later. Our Cat Spring technicians build that record as part of every job.
